Detailed Comparison: Sildenafil vs Tadalafil

How Sildenafil and Cialis Work

Both sildenafil 50mg and Cialis (tadalafil) belong to a class of medications called PDE5 inhibitors. They work by blocking the phosphodiesterase type 5 enzyme, which increases blood flow to the penis during sexual arousal. Neither medication causes automatic erections - sexual stimulation is still required for them to work effectively.

Onset Time and Duration Differences

Sildenafil typically begins working within 30-60 minutes of taking it, with effects lasting approximately 4-6 hours. This doesn't mean an erection lasts this entire time, but rather that the medication remains active in your system. Cialis, on the other hand, can take 30 minutes to 2 hours to work but may remain effective for up to 36 hours, earning it the nickname "the weekend pill".

Food and Alcohol Interactions

Sildenafil can be affected by food, particularly high-fat meals, which may delay its onset of action. Cialis is less affected by food intake, making it more flexible for meal timing. Both medications can interact with alcohol, potentially increasing the risk of side effects like dizziness or low blood pressure.

Side Effect Profiles

Common side effects for both medications include headache, flushing, indigestion, and nasal congestion. Sildenafil may cause temporary visual disturbances in some patients, while Cialis might cause back pain or muscle aches. Most side effects are mild and temporary, but serious side effects, though rare, require immediate medical attention.

Which Option Might Suit You Better?

Sildenafil 50mg may be preferable if you prefer a shorter duration of action, want a more cost-effective option, or are trying ED medication for the first time. The 50mg dose is typically the starting point, which can be adjusted to 25mg or 100mg based on effectiveness and tolerability. Cialis might be better suited for those wanting more spontaneity in their intimate relationships due to its longer window of effectiveness.

What is Erectile Dysfunction?
ED means finding it hard to get or keep an erection firm enough for sex. It's not unusual to have an off night; the point at which it's worth doing something is when it's happening regularly, or when it's starting to bother you.
How will I feel when I take ED medication?
For most men, nothing feels different day to day. The medication works in the background — when you're sexually aroused, it helps blood flow where it's needed, so erections come more easily and last longer. It doesn't cause arousal on its own. Some men notice mild, short-lived effects like a headache, facial flushing or a stuffy nose, which usually pass as the dose wears off.
Why do I need a prescription for ED medication?
ED treatments are prescription-only medicines in the UK because they aren't suitable for everyone — for example, alongside certain heart conditions or medications like nitrates.
